Industrial motors rarely fail overnight. Most of the time, machines begin showing subtle behavioural changes that maintenance teams notice during regular operations. The motor may heat faster than usual, lose pulling strength, or produce inconsistent output under load conditions.
Kirloskar motors are widely used across industrial sectors because of their durability and operational efficiency. But like any heavily used equipment, regular servicing becomes important after continuous working cycles. Heat stress, dust exposure, overload conditions, and electrical fluctuations gradually affect internal motor components over time.
One challenge many industries face is identifying whether the issue requires complete replacement or technical repair. In reality, several motor problems can be corrected through proper inspection and servicing. Rewinding correction, insulation improvement, bearing replacement, and alignment adjustments often help restore equipment stability without replacing the entire motor system.
